How much does it cost to rent an apartment in South Station?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| South Station Studio Apartments | $1,269 | $1,172 | $1,412 |
| South Station 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,472 | $733 | $2,661 |
| South Station 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,793 | $1,151 | $3,620 |
| South Station 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,204 | $1,729 | $3,260 |
| South Station 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,588 | $2,576 | $2,601 |
